Saxon 5/4 Math Home School Review

Saxon 5/4 Math Home School Review

My nine year old daughter used Saxon Math 5/4 home school curriculum the first semester we homeschooled. We purchased it based on many good reviews I read on-line. Unfortunately I didn't know enough about her learning style when we started homeschooling to know this was not the curriculum for her!

Saxon teaches a new concept, has a few problems on the new concept and then launches into review problems that may cover any lesson already taught in the book. This incremental spiral approach works for some students but my daughter really needed to master a topic with a little bit of review (mastery approach) rather than just an introduction to a topic and then a lot of review. Before beginning Saxon she had been doing advanced math for her age and grade but with Saxon she grew so frustrated she really slowed down.

Saxon math
by: Anonymous

For us it was the same with Saxon 8/7: the short spiral is not the way my kids are learning - and not the way I want them to learn math. We prefer to stay on a topic until it is thoroughly mastered, and then move on to the next *realeted* topic- Saxon jumps between completely unrelated topics.
The other thing we all disliked was the fact that Saxon, while stressing the usefulness of math, is completely devoid of excitement and joy. I did not get the sensation that the authors themselves love math and find it tremendous fun to do math.

We have switched to The Art of Problem Solving and are completely happy with it. No short spiral, a very thorough treatment of each topic, and it is obvious that the authors love their subject - we feel it in every page.
